Pharoahe Monch Interview with K-Salaam
Some deep ish here for you Monch fans
I think some true Hip Hop heads will agree with me when I say that Pharoahe Monch is one of the most underrated emcees in the history of the art form. I didn’t say the greatest, but he definately deserves more respect than he’s ever received from his early days with Organized Konfusion to his solo works. Here’s an in depth interview with Monch courtesy of OkayPlayer and conducted by K-Salaam. In part one he goes int about his early years, what hip hop means to him and biting styles. In part two he touches on his “Top 5″ and of course Barack Obama.
